Use Public Transportation Rather than Driving a Car

For most people, you are going to need to do at least a small amount of commuting around the city. Whether it be to and from work, out to shops and restaurants, and just visiting friends rather than buying a vehicle, a greener option is to use public transportation.
The city of Birmingham is very easy to get around by bus, metro, train, and even on a bicycle. Each of these options will leave less of a footprint and have you feeling better about how you get from point A to B.
If public transportation isn’t going to work with your needs due to scheduling or the routes, then maybe you could carpool with others.
 

Swap Out Old Appliances for Energy Efficient Ones

As your appliances age, they start to become out-of-date where technology is concerned, and part of that technology has to do with the amount of energy they use. If you’ve got items that are more than five years old, chances are they are using a lot more energy than is necessary. You may want to consider swapping them out for new appliances that aren’t energy wasters. As an added bonus they will save you money on your electrical bill.

Create an Outdoor Garden

If you have an outdoor space where you live, then you can do a big favour for the environment and plant some greenery. Creating a garden allows you to give back to the earth. An added tip is to plant items that pollinators are interested in. This can include things such as Lemon Balm and Butterfly Bushes.
Depending on the outdoor space you have, you can also take your garden one step further and plant fruits and vegetables. Growing your own organic food is an excellent way to create less waste, and also enjoy a healthier chemical-free lifestyle.

Familiarize Yourself with Local Recycling Programs

Unfortunately, when it comes to recycling rates, Birmingham posts some of the lowest numbers. A recent report showed that only 24.4% of materials were recycled per household. These are some rather dismal numbers, but it doesn’t mean you have to live by them. Make it your goal to familiarize yourself with the local recycling programs and then throw yourself into taking part.

Be Conscious of Your Water Usage

One tip that not everyone thinks about is water usage. There are a number of things you can do in your home to cut back on the amount of water you use, such as installing low-flow toilets and showerheads. These will still get the job done but use much less water.
Speaking of water usage, it’s also a good idea to examine the water you drink. Do you buy bottled water? If so you are contributing to a massive amount of waste that just keeps growing in the landfill sites. A greener option is to buy a reusable stainless steel mug/container that you can just keep refilling with water. You can then buy a water filtration system to use in your home that can attach to your tap, fridge, or may even just be in a water container that you store in the fridge. It sounds like a small thing, but imagine if everyone at least cut back on the number of water bottles being used.
